my 3rd HHR SS

These cars give you great fuel economy along with superb performance and lots of cargo space. My 5 speed SS HHR wil run 158mph top end after having it tuned by trifecta tunes. These cars were built to be tuner cars to compete with imports. Chevy hit a homerun with the SS model. A mustang GT is a joke. They sound good, but can't compete with a tuned HHR SS 5 speed car. And still the thing gets 34mpg on the hwy! If you buy an SS model have it tuned and you'll get more mpg and lots more performance.
